Transaction 71ee5e88688ae1817589b863300f044218a16f5b8c1391b31499164f0c4ac686

2 Input
1 Outputs
  • 71ee5e88688ae1817589b863300f044218a16f5b8c1391b31499164f0c4ac686:0
  • value  20000000
    address  16C6GQFiEnUcDg3P5mapYsBgMYzkz2vLFT